What Our Traffic Violation Attorneys Handle
Traffic cases cover more ground than most drivers realize, and the right approach depends heavily on what you are actually charged with. We regularly help clients with:
- Speeding tickets and other moving violations
- Red light, stop sign, and lane violation citations
- Negligent or reckless operation charges
- Driving with a suspended or revoked license
- Uninsured or unregistered vehicle citations
- Cell phone and texting-while-driving violations
- Junior operator law violations for drivers under 18
Some of these are civil infractions that carry a fine. Others, like negligent operation or driving on a suspended license, are criminal charges that can lead to a record, additional fines, and even jail time. Knowing which category your citation falls into changes everything about how it should be handled.

Traffic Court in Lynn: What to Expect
Traffic citations issued in Lynn are typically handled at Lynn District Court, located at 580 Essex Street, which also serves Marblehead, Nahant, Saugus, and Swampscott. If you decide to contest a citation rather than pay it, you will need to request a hearing within the response window listed on your ticket.

Frequently Asked Questions
Do I have to go to court for a traffic ticket in Lynn, MA?
Not always. Many civil citations can be paid without a hearing, but if you want to contest the ticket or if it involves a criminal charge, you will need to appear at Lynn District Court.
Can a traffic ticket affect my insurance rates?
Yes. Traffic violations are considered surchargeable incidents in Massachusetts and are reported to the Merit Rating Board, which insurance companies use to set your premiums.
What happens if I ignore a ticket from Lynn?
Ignoring a citation does not make it go away. Unpaid tickets lead to late fees and can eventually result in a license suspension, so it is worth addressing the ticket or speaking with an attorney before the response deadline passes.
Is a license suspension hearing different from a traffic ticket hearing?
Yes. A suspension hearing addresses whether your license or right to operate should be restored, while a traffic ticket hearing addresses whether the citation itself was properly issued. Our team can help with either situation.
